History

Maple Leaf Kingsley International School was founded in 2011 by Mr. Jeffrey Siew and Madam Susan Tay. It was established as a "homegrown" international school in Malaysia with the aim of providing an education that blends different educational philosophies. The school is now a part of Maple Leaf Educational Systems (MLES), an organisation that operates schools across Asia and was originally founded in 1995 with a model that merged Canadian and Chinese educational approaches.

Community

The school has a diverse community, with a student body composed of both Malaysian and international students from various countries. This multicultural environment is a key aspect of the school's identity. The school encourages community and cultural understanding through various activities and a curriculum that promotes global citizenship. A tradition at the boarding hall involves new students leaving a painted palm print on a wall, creating a visual legacy and fostering a sense of belonging.

Parent-Teacher Association

The school does not have a traditional Parent Teacher Association (PTA). Instead, it facilitates communication and parental involvement through regular event sessions and a dedicated online Parent-Teacher portal. This platform allows parents to monitor their child's academic progress, receive updates and announcements, and communicate with teachers. The school also encourages parents to be involved in the learning process through access to platforms like Google Classroom.

Maple Leaf Kingsley International School offers a British-based curriculum for students aged 3 to 18., preparing students for IGCSE and A-Level examinations. The school is situated on a 16-acre campus and includes facilities such as an Olympic-sized swimming pool, a 120-seat auditorium, and various sports courts. A distinctive feature of the school is its "Learning Journeys" program. This initiative provides students with real-world experiences through day excursions for primary students and overnight camps for secondary students, aiming to connect classroom learning with practical exploration.
